What happens when you achieve everything you thought you wanted, only to realise you have become disconnected from yourself along the way? In this deeply honest and insightful conversation, specialist prosthodontist and integrative psychotherapist Dr Aditi Bhalla shares her journey from professional success and burnout to discovering a completely different way of understanding wellbeing, fulfilment and what it really means to thrive. Together, we explore why so many high achievers ignore the warning signs, the connection between mind and body, and why prevention matters just as much in our own lives as it does in healthcare. We discuss the difference between coaching and therapy, the importance of understanding ourselves before trying to change others, and practical ways to build resilience before reaching crisis point. Aditi Bhalla is a Prosthodontist and Integrative Psychotherapist, with over 15 years in dentistry and extensive training in mental health, mindfulness, and movement, she helps dental professionals prevent burnout through practical, compassionate tools. She is the founder of Compassion Focused Dentistry- a structured, science-backed program designed to support practitioner wellbeing and prevent burnout. After personally experiencing burnout, anxiety, and De Quervain’s tenosynovitis, Aditi set out to create spaces where prevention is the focus and wellbeing is key. This led to the birth of the Dental Wellbeing Hub- a platform offering practical, preventative tools to help dental professionals manage stress, reduce anxiety, and avoid burnout.
Aditi offers wellbeing workshops, team training, and one-to-one therapeutic support. And when she’s not doing this work, you’ll find he immersed in motherhood and the messy magic of everyday life.
